Water treatment services involve the process of improving the quality of water for various uses, including drinking, bathing, and household chores. Professionals in this field typically assess water sources, identify contaminants, and implement solutions such as filtration systems, water softeners, or purification units. These services ensure that water meets safety standards and is free from impurities that could cause health issues or damage to appliances and plumbing.
Many common problems can be addressed through water treatment services. These include hard water deposits, which can lead to scale buildup and reduce the efficiency of appliances, as well as contaminants like iron, manganese, chlorine, or bacteria that affect water taste, smell, and safety. Proper treatment can also remove sediments and other particles that can clog pipes or cause discoloration in fixtures, helping to maintain the longevity and performance of household plumbing systems.
Various types of properties utilize water treatment services, ranging from residential homes to commercial buildings. Single-family homes often require treatment to improve water quality for daily use, while apartment complexes and multi-family dwellings may need larger-scale systems to serve multiple units. Commercial properties, such as restaurants, hotels, and healthcare facilities, often depend on advanced water treatment solutions to meet health regulations and ensure the safety of their water supplies.

Discover typical Water Treatment Service project ranges for Utica, MI.
Water Treatment Service Costs - Typical costs for water treatment services range from $300 to $1,500 depending on system size and complexity. Basic filtration system installations may cost around $300 to $800, while more advanced treatments can exceed $1,200.
Installation Expenses - Installing a new water treatment system generally costs between $500 and $2,000. Factors influencing the price include system type, home size, and existing plumbing conditions, with average installations around $1,000.
Maintenance Fees - Routine maintenance for water treatment systems usually falls between $100 and $300 annually. This includes filter replacements, system checks, and minor repairs, with costs varying based on system type and usage.
Replacement Costs - Replacing filters or other system components can range from $50 to $200 per part. Complete system replacements may cost $1,000 or more, depending on the system's capacity and features.

What types of water treatment services are available? Local service providers offer a range of solutions including water filtration, softening, and purification systems to improve water quality.
How do I know if my water needs treatment? Professionals can assess your water supply through testing to determine if treatment is necessary for issues like hardness, contaminants, or odors.
Are water treatment systems difficult to maintain? Maintenance requirements vary by system, but many providers offer ongoing support and guidance to ensure optimal performance.
What are common signs indicating water treatment is needed? Signs include foul odors, unusual taste, discoloration, or visible particles in the water supply.
